The new houses on the site of an old shoe factory. Contrast them with the older houses in the street.
36 & 38 Moor Road - Note datestone and name of terrace. Contrast the houses in the row with the older houses opposite.
Between many of the older parts of houses there is a third doorway. Why was this?
Three storey factory of the older kind. Note the external wall hoist.
This factory has iron framed windows on one side and wooden framed ones on the other.
Note the position of No 23.
Stone Cottages with pantile roofs. Are those of the original style of Rushden building before brick and slate took over?
How does this terrace compare for age with most of the other houses seen on the trail?
Small workshops belonging to Lockie & Son. Notice two storey arrangement - what might have been their original use?
See the datestone and name - and the object depicted on the keystone over the doorway.
